Indications of Oral Emergency Situations
Identifying the indicators of dental emergency situations is crucial for prompt action and proper therapy. If you experience serious tooth discomfort that's constant and throbbing, it might suggest an underlying concern that calls for prompt attention.
Swelling in the gums, face, or jaw can additionally signify a dental emergency, especially if it's accompanied by pain or fever. Any kind of kind of trauma to the mouth resulting in a broken, damaged, or knocked-out tooth ought to be treated as an emergency situation to avoid more damage and potential infection.
Hemorrhaging from the mouth that doesn't quit after using pressure for a few minutes is an additional warning that you need to seek emergency dental care. Furthermore, if you notice any kind of indicators of infection such as pus, a nasty taste in your mouth, or a fever, it's necessary to see a dental expert as soon as possible.
Overlooking these signs could bring about a lot more significant difficulties, so it's critical to act swiftly when confronted with a potential dental emergency situation.
